Transaction 05ffba3494cda102deb907e3c11a62d14aa852420400eea3ac36a48dccab08dd

1 Input
2 Outputs
  • 05ffba3494cda102deb907e3c11a62d14aa852420400eea3ac36a48dccab08dd:0
  • value  9880000
    address  161fukUg4oWea8Uy8dQEUmjUnYuommqb4F
  • 05ffba3494cda102deb907e3c11a62d14aa852420400eea3ac36a48dccab08dd:1
  • value  246832289
    address  3DAcfKJ2x5HPDnwQc6WGaAyVd2GdDYka7Z